[jira] Created: (HADOOP-3756) dfs.client.buffer.dir isn't used in hdfs, but it's still in conf/hadoop-default.xml

dfs.client.buffer.dir isn't used in hdfs, but it's still in conf/hadoop-default.xml
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------

                 Key: HADOOP-3756
                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-3756
             Project: Hadoop Core
          Issue Type: Bug
            Reporter: Michael Bieniosek


It looks like the usage of the config variable dfs.client.buffer.dir was removed in 612903, but the variable lives on in the conf/hadoop-default.xml configuration file.  If this variable really isn't used anymore, maybe we should remove it from the hadoop-default.xml file?
